Peroxocarbonate production by using a divided cylindrical electrochemical reactor

Resumen

The production of peroxocarbonate was studied in a cylindrical electrochemical reactor divided by a cationic exchange membrane. The anode was a platinum helical wire and the cathodic reaction was either oxygen reduction by using a rotating reticulated vitreous carbon or hydrogen evolution at nickel or platinised titanium static electrodes. Fundamental studies performed with a rotating disc electrode or a rotating ring-disc electrode are reported which orientate the adoption of the operating conditions for the cylindrical reactor. The best results were obtained using a 1 mol/dm3 Na2CO3 solution in the anodic compartment at a current density of 140 mA/cm2 and 10 °C of temperature. The maximum sodium peroxocarbonate concentration was 64.7 mmol/dm3 with a current efficiency of 19.2%. The space time yield was 5.4 kg/m3/h and 11.1 kW h/kg the specific energy consumption. The process performance is similar with both cathodic reactions. The reactor showed a promising behaviour for the electrosynthesis of this oxidising agent.
